All Tamil and Pashto Dialects

Most languages have dialects where each dialect differ from other dialect with respect to grammar and vocabulary. Here you will get to know all Tamil and Pashto dialects. Various dialects of Tamil and Pashto language differ in their pronunciations and words. Dialects of Tamil are spoken in different Tamil Speaking Countries whereas Pashto Dialects are spoken in different Pashto speaking countries. Also the number of people speaking Tamil vs Pashto Dialects varies from few thousands to many millions. Some of the Tamil dialects include: Kongu, Madurai Tamil. Tamil and Pashto Speaking population

Tamil and Pashto speaking population is one of the factors based on which Tamil and Pashto languages can be compared. The total count of Tamil and Pashto Speaking population in percentage is also given. The percentage of people speaking Tamil language is 1.06 % whereas the percentage of people speaking Pashto language is 0.58 %. When we compare the speaking population of any two languages we get to know which of two languages is more popular.
